titleOfInvention |
Dental bonding agents |
abstract |
Abstract of the Disclosure A bonding agent composition for use in dental restorations for bonding porcelain to the metal core or framework, especially framework of non-precious metal alloys. The bonding agent composition comprises: (a) a bond-forming component comprising a powdered mixture of aluminum and a glass which fuses at a temperature in the range of from about 1750°F to about 1850°F and (b) ? liquid carrier. The carrier is preferably one capable of ? viding a reducing atmosphere at temperatures within the range of from about 1200°F to about 1900°F. The bonding agent composition is applied to a metal core which is to be faced with porcelain and heated from about 1200°F. to a temperature in the range of about 1750°F. to 1900°F. to produce a very strong bond at the interface resistant to separation of the porcelain by stresses placed upon the restoration during use. |
